Hykeham Sailing Club, 26th & 27th June 2010
Perfect hot and sunny conditions and a warm, friendly welcome greeted
the competitors at Hykeham SC for the Gill-sponsored National 12 Summer
Event, the 4th event in the Gill Series. The wind was a relatively
lively force 3 with hints of force 4, made all the more interesting by
the PROs, Pete Bayliss and Sam Mason, setting a course so that the fleet
could not only see all the sights of the lake, but they would also have
all the thrills and spills of regularly navigating through the rather
challenging calm patch in the lee of the island.
Locals Stevie and Joanne Sallis had the measure of the shifty wind and
led at the first mark. The gusty marginal planing conditions seemed to
give an advantage to those with wings on their rudders and, after
recovering from a mediocre first beat, Jon Ibbotson and Charlotte
Stewart worked their way to the front, followed home by Stevie and
Joanne and Andy McKee and Clare Hunter.
In the second race, early leaders Kevin Iles and Jane Wade were chased
by the Dead Cat Bounces of Stevie and Joanne and Jon and Char. These
three pulled away from the chasing pack and had a close race with much
place changing, until Jon and Char edged ahead to take the win from
Kevin and Jane with Stevie and Joanne taking third.
Despite the challengingly early start on Sunday morning after a lively
evening thanks to the Hykeham Sailing Club's hospitality, most
competitors were up well in advance of racing - perhaps excitement as
they prepared for the impending Summer Event Pursuit Race, or maybe
because they were driven out of their tents at an uncharacteristically
early hour due to the unbearable midsummer heat? They were greeted by a
few light zephyrs on the lake, taking turns to come in randomly from
every direction, conditions which were to prevail for the rest of the
day's racing.
In the Pursuit Race, the early-starting clinker boats of Brian Herring
and Roz Stevenson and Howard Chadwick and Helen Nicholson, sailing
unimpeded by the fleet, held the lead for much longer than they had
expected. Eventually the Feeling Foolishes of Christian and Sophie and
Daniel Sallis and Robin Jones and the Paradigm of Dave Peacock and
Tricia Woods made a break from the close-packed fleet, but they were not
to have it all their own way as a puff of wind on the run bunched the
fleet up even more and threatened to turn things inside out. Yet again.
However, these three boats prevailed and the fleet collectively sighed
with relief when the race officer signaled the full 70 minutes had been
completed, with Christian and Sophie taking the race from Dave and Trish
and Daniel and Robin in third.
A break for elevenses turned into a postponement and an early lunch to
await the wind, with long periods of dead calm covering one or other
half of the lake. When even the model yacht racers called it a day it
looked as though that would be it for racing, but something vaguely
resembling a light and shifty breeze appeared just as the time limit was
about to expire. By the time the start sequence was under way, the wind
had swung by 90 degrees so the first leg turned into a fetchy reach and
the competitors were able to briefly stretch their legs and sit on the
side decks. Jon and Char led until the wind reverted to its tricks of
the morning and they found a windless hole. Christian and Sophie
took the lead which they held to the finish.
For the final race, the wind occasionally hinted at the perfect
conditions which would settle in later, once the fleet was off the water
and packing up for home, but as the race got under way it still
maintained much of the morning's instability. With early leaders Stevie
and Joanne choosing to sacrifice their race in the interests of testing
the weed-harvesting capabilities of their new winged rudder, Jon and
Char this time managed to dodge the wind holes to win, with Christian
and Sophie second and John Cheetham and Anna Jones third.
